Straws enjoy successful trip to Wales
IT was another busy day for Macclesfield Boys’ Boxing Club recently as Joe Straw was involved in a show taking place at Mealor ABC near Wrexham.
Six of the MBBC coaches from the gym were attending a training course and two others where providing a demonstration session over at St John’s Church as part of their community partnership event, so that left just Donna Shaw to cover the show over in Wales.
After some negotiations, Joe was moved from bout eleven to bout five as other commitments meat the coaches needed to be back in Macclesfield as early as possible.
Joe was determined to get the win to equal his brother Noel’s increasing record of wins and hopefully stop the banter in the gym.
Joe entered the ring and his opponent was home boxer Carl Roberts, so it was clear that it was going to be a tough old session.
The bell rang and Straw went to work, throwing combinations at will with good solid grounding, inflicting some beautiful powerful shots in Roberts’ direction, who was no push over and took the shots in his stride.
This was the format for the next two rounds, as it was a tough scrap, with both kids giving their all and the crowd were loving it.
It was Straw who had the better work rate and the better shots, resulting in him taking the win on a split, but in reality he didn’t drop any of the rounds so it should have been unanimous.
